APC Governorship Candidate — Adamawa Christian Association Denies Backing

In a recent development, the Christian Association of Nigeria, Adamawa State Chapter, has come out to refute claims that it endorsed the All Progressives Congress governorship candidate, Tijani Galadima. According to a statement issued by the Adamawa CAN Chairman, Mr. Joel Manzo, the association has distanced itself from the purported endorsement. The statement, which was made available to the public, addressed concerns raised by members of the Christian community and the general public regarding a recent visit by a group of women who claimed to be leaders representing Christians in Adamawa State and publicly declared support for Galadima as 'God's chosen candidate.' The leadership of CAN Adamawa State Chapter made it clear that neither the association nor any of its recognized organs authorized such a representation or pronouncement. As the umbrella body of Christians in Adamawa State, CAN recognizes that many of its members are active participants in different political parties and may individually aspire for elective offices or support candidates of their choice. The association views the development with serious concern and has called on those involved to exercise greater caution and responsibility. Mr. Manzo stated that it is inappropriate for any individual or group to make declarations or endorsements on behalf of CAN without the consent and approval of the duly constituted leadership of the association. Such actions, he said, have the potential to create misunderstanding, sow seeds of division among believers, and undermine the unity for which the Church stands. The association has directed the individuals or organisations involved in the alleged unlawful endorsement to issue a public statement clarifying that their position was solely their own and not that of CAN Adamawa State Chapter or its recognized organs. CAN Adamawa State Chapter stressed that it bears no ill feelings toward any political aspirant and remains committed to neutrality while encouraging all citizens to participate responsibly in the democratic process. The association appealed to youths, church members, and all concerned Christians to refrain from making inflammatory comments, circulating unverified information, or engaging in actions that may further aggravate the situation. At this critical moment, CAN encouraged all believers to remain calm, prayerful, and attentive to God's direction and leadership.
